1904 Print Pooise Nansies Hostelry Jolly Begger Fashion George Gibson XGO4 SF1 a tidal watercourse on HalligThis is an original 1904 halftone print of Poosie Nansei's Hostelry, an inn located in Mauchline, in Ayrshire, Scotland. It was owned by George Gibson's wife, and was requented often by famous Scottish poet Robert Burns, and was the inspiration for "The Jolly Beggars."
